Recognizing the indications that your patio door rollers need attention is the initial step towards a successful repair. Here are some common indicators:

Difficulty Opening or Closing: If your door sticks or needs extreme force to run, it's most likely time for a roller examination.

Noticeable Wear or Damage: Inspect the rollers for fractures, chips, or substantial wear. This can indicate they require changing.

Uncommon Noises: Grinding or scraping sounds when running the door can signal that the rollers are not operating efficiently.

Misalignment: If the door appears misaligned or doesn't line up correctly with the frame, the rollers may be out of order.

Unscrew the Roller Housing: Locate the screws at the bottom of the door where the roller real estate is attached. Remove these screws using a screwdriver.

Raise the Door: Carefully lift the door upwards to separate it from the track. It may assist to tilt the bottom external slightly for simpler elimination.
Action 2: Inspect and Remove the Rollers
Analyze the Rollers: Check the rollers for damage. If they are damaged or excessively used, they will require to be changed.

Eliminate the Old Rollers: Unscrew the rollers from their real estate if they are adjustable. If not, you may need to pry them out carefully.
Action 3: Install New Rollers
Select Replacement Rollers: Based on your measurements, pick the right type and size of replacement rollers.

Set Up New Rollers: Attach the new rollers to the housing, ensuring they fit snugly.
Step 4: Clean the Track
Eliminate Debris: Use a cleansing cloth to clean down the track, removing dirt and particles that may prevent smooth operation.

Lubricate the Track: Apply a silicone-based lube to the track to ensure smooth motion.
Step 5: Reinstall the Door
Align the Door: Carefully place the door back into the track.

Secure the Housing: Reattach the screws that hold the roller real estate in place to secure the rollers.
Step 6: Test the Door
Open and Close: Gently test the door by opening and closing it a number of times to ensure everything is working efficiently.

Make Adjustments: If the door is still misaligned or does not operate properly, adjust the height utilizing the adjustment screws on the roller.
FAQs about Patio Door Roller RepairQ1: How often should I examine my patio door rollers?
A1: It's a good concept to inspect your patio door rollers a minimum of as soon as a year, particularly if you discover any indications of wear or concerns.
Q2: Can I repair the rollers without eliminating the door?
A2: While some repair work might be possible without getting rid of the door, it is generally much easier and more reliable to take the door off the track for extensive repair work.
Q3: What should I do if I can't find replacement rollers?
A3: If you can not find the exact replacement rollers, take the old ones to a hardware store or speak with a regional door repair professional for alternatives.
Q4: Is it worth fixing old rollers?
A4: If your patio door remains in normally excellent condition, fixing the rollers is frequently worth it. Nevertheless, if the door is old or has other substantial concerns, it may be more cost-efficient to think about a replacement.
Q5: What is the best lube to use for patio door rollers?
A5: Silicone-based lubricants are extremely advised for [Patio Door Roller Repair](https://frantzen-andresen-3.blogbright.net/20-questions-you-should-have-to-ask-about-patio-door-hardware-repair-before-purchasing-it) door rollers, as they provide outstanding security versus dirt and grime without drawing in dust.
